Consider sub-commands for the watchmaker cli #1041

Right now, running watchmaker will immediately start executing. A safer default would be just to print the help. The current functionality could be implemented behind a sub-command, instead, e.g. watchmaker run. This would be introduced without changing the current behavior, just implementing the sub-command(s) and printing a deprecation warning when invoked without a sub-command.

Some sub-command ideas...

  • init - Copy config file to /etc/watchmaker.yaml or /etc/watchmaker/config.yaml
  • install - Invoke an install method from workers in the config, intended to install the config mgmt pkgs
  • run - Invoke the run method from workers, intended to run the config mgmt tool
  • clean - Invoke the clean method from workers, intended to remove config mgmt pkgs (not any hardening applied by the tool)
  • worker - Run a specific worker from the config
